On this day in 1999, during the 3rd night of NATO air strikes over Serbia, an F-117A Nighthawk has been shot down by a SA-3 missile battery whose technology was dating back to the 60's. It was a slap in a face for the United States and their stealthy technology which was defeated for the first time in ten years of operations. Very fortunately, the pilot managed to hide in a drainage ditch after he ejected. A helicopter combat search & rescue operation would peak him up in the early morning.
